The one worry I had was that I didn’t think they could
possible offer me enough support in the top region. I’ve usually have had to go for
underwire swimsuits and the Miraclesuit has no bulky wire construction….What
they do have though is a one piece moulded bra that has wires built into the
foam. It does mean no sudden jabs as the suit gets older and the wires pop through! I was sent the Must Haves Oceanus which is a gorgeous shade of purple, has soft cups, a v neck
and lovely two fold effect at the front which creates a lovely layered look to
lead the eye away from the tummy. The special Miratex fabric boasts three times
the holding power of a normal swimsuit. So had did I find it…
